Network of cross-platform collaborative text processing system, is a collaborativeoffice software. In this way, users can edit the file at the same time. As other networkservices, user can use the computer connected to the Internet through a browser to accessthe system,and can also access the serveice by all kinds of mobile phones, Tablet PC. inthis way can enhance coordination effective. The main contents are as follows.First, this project research the CSCW theory, discusses the existing text collaborativeediting limitations on the use of client, then proposed a text-based browser collaborativeediting system program to improve the collaborative editing system in the fat client on theinstallation and use of inconvenience.Secondly, based on the dispersion characteristics of the collaborative work indifferent space, used a distributed system to improve system scalability and reducemaintenance costs. And according to the characteristics of the high concurrency of thedistributed system use the Brower/Server mode as the system architecture.Again, based on the DOM properties and Javascript technology to achieve a systemof edit text can be visualized in the Web environment. Using HTML5+CSS3technologyto build the system interface, to optimize Web front-end code. Using Ajax technology fordynamic data interaction, improve system performance, improving the user experience.Finally, on the basis of analysis of typical collaborative editing conflict, then usingthe serial algorithm to solve the problem of concurrent data inconsistencies. Based of theintroduction of the state vector, solved the problem of inconsistent concurrent process ofcause and effect. Use the transform function to solve the problem of the concurrentprocess operations willingness inconsistent. Based on the overall consistency of the modeland transform algorithm to solve more complex context consistent problem.
